   25: /*
   26:  * Grid view functions. These work using coordinates relative to the visible
   27:  * screen area.
   28:  */
   29: 
   30: #define grid_view_x(gd, x) (x)
   31: #define grid_view_y(gd, y) ((gd)->hsize + (y))
   32: 
   33: /* Get cell. */
   34: void
   35: grid_view_get_cell(struct grid *gd, u_int px, u_int py, struct grid_cell *gc)
   36: {
   37: 	grid_get_cell(gd, grid_view_x(gd, px), grid_view_y(gd, py), gc);
   38: }
   39: 
   40: /* Set cell. */
   41: void
   42: grid_view_set_cell(struct grid *gd, u_int px, u_int py,
   43:     const struct grid_cell *gc)
   44: {
   45: 	grid_set_cell(gd, grid_view_x(gd, px), grid_view_y(gd, py), gc);
   46: }
   47: 
   48: /* Set cells. */
   49: void
   50: grid_view_set_cells(struct grid *gd, u_int px, u_int py,
   51:     const struct grid_cell *gc, const char *s, size_t slen)
   52: {
   53: 	grid_set_cells(gd, grid_view_x(gd, px), grid_view_y(gd, py), gc, s,
   54: 	    slen);
   55: }
   56: 
   57: /* Clear into history. */
   58: void
   59: grid_view_clear_history(struct grid *gd, u_int bg)
   60: {
   61: 	struct grid_line	*gl;
   62: 	u_int			 yy, last;
   63: 
   64: 	/* Find the last used line. */
   65: 	last = 0;
   66: 	for (yy = 0; yy < gd->sy; yy++) {
   67: 		gl = &gd->linedata[grid_view_y(gd, yy)];
   68: 		if (gl->cellused != 0)
   69: 			last = yy + 1;
   70: 	}
   71: 	if (last == 0) {
   72: 		grid_view_clear(gd, 0, 0, gd->sx, gd->sy, bg);
   73: 		return;
   74: 	}
   75: 
   76: 	/* Scroll the lines into the history. */
   77: 	for (yy = 0; yy < last; yy++) {
   78: 		grid_collect_history(gd, bg);
   79: 		grid_scroll_history(gd, bg);
   80: 	}
   81: 	if (last < gd->sy)
   82: 		grid_view_clear(gd, 0, 0, gd->sx, gd->sy - last, bg);
   83: 	gd->hscrolled = 0;
   84: }
   85: 
   86: /* Clear area. */
   87: void
   88: grid_view_clear(struct grid *gd, u_int px, u_int py, u_int nx, u_int ny,
   89:     u_int bg)
   90: {
   91: 	px = grid_view_x(gd, px);
   92: 	py = grid_view_y(gd, py);
   93: 
   94: 	grid_clear(gd, px, py, nx, ny, bg);
   95: }
   96: 
   97: /* Scroll region up. */
   98: void
   99: grid_view_scroll_region_up(struct grid *gd, u_int rupper, u_int rlower)
  100: {
  101: 	if (gd->flags & GRID_HISTORY) {
  102: 		grid_collect_history(gd, 8);
  103: 		if (rupper == 0 && rlower == gd->sy - 1)
  104: 			grid_scroll_history(gd, 8);
  105: 		else {
  106: 			rupper = grid_view_y(gd, rupper);
  107: 			rlower = grid_view_y(gd, rlower);
  108: 			grid_scroll_history_region(gd, rupper, rlower);
  109: 		}
  110: 	} else {
  111: 		rupper = grid_view_y(gd, rupper);
  112: 		rlower = grid_view_y(gd, rlower);
  113: 		grid_move_lines(gd, rupper, rupper + 1, rlower - rupper, 8);
  114: 	}
  115: }
  116: 
  117: /* Scroll region down. */
  118: void
  119: grid_view_scroll_region_down(struct grid *gd, u_int rupper, u_int rlower)
  120: {
  121: 	rupper = grid_view_y(gd, rupper);
  122: 	rlower = grid_view_y(gd, rlower);
  123: 
  124: 	grid_move_lines(gd, rupper + 1, rupper, rlower - rupper, 8);
  125: }
  126: 
  127: /* Insert lines. */
  128: void
  129: grid_view_insert_lines(struct grid *gd, u_int py, u_int ny, u_int bg)
  130: {
  131: 	u_int	sy;
  132: 
  133: 	py = grid_view_y(gd, py);
  134: 
  135: 	sy = grid_view_y(gd, gd->sy);
  136: 
  137: 	grid_move_lines(gd, py + ny, py, sy - py - ny, bg);
  138: }
  139: 
  140: /* Insert lines in region. */
  141: void
  142: grid_view_insert_lines_region(struct grid *gd, u_int rlower, u_int py,
  143:     u_int ny, u_int bg)
  144: {
  145: 	u_int	ny2;
  146: 
  147: 	rlower = grid_view_y(gd, rlower);
  148: 
  149: 	py = grid_view_y(gd, py);
  150: 
  151: 	ny2 = rlower + 1 - py - ny;
  152: 	grid_move_lines(gd, rlower + 1 - ny2, py, ny2, bg);
  153: 	grid_clear(gd, 0, py + ny2, gd->sx, ny - ny2, bg);
  154: }
  155: 
  156: /* Delete lines. */
  157: void
  158: grid_view_delete_lines(struct grid *gd, u_int py, u_int ny, u_int bg)
  159: {
  160: 	u_int	sy;
  161: 
  162: 	py = grid_view_y(gd, py);
  163: 
  164: 	sy = grid_view_y(gd, gd->sy);
  165: 
  166: 	grid_move_lines(gd, py, py + ny, sy - py - ny, bg);
  167: 	grid_clear(gd, 0, sy - ny, gd->sx, py + ny - (sy - ny), bg);
  168: }
  169: 
  170: /* Delete lines inside scroll region. */
  171: void
  172: grid_view_delete_lines_region(struct grid *gd, u_int rlower, u_int py,
  173:     u_int ny, u_int bg)
  174: {
  175: 	u_int	ny2;
  176: 
  177: 	rlower = grid_view_y(gd, rlower);
  178: 
  179: 	py = grid_view_y(gd, py);
  180: 
  181: 	ny2 = rlower + 1 - py - ny;
  182: 	grid_move_lines(gd, py, py + ny, ny2, bg);
  183: 	grid_clear(gd, 0, py + ny2, gd->sx, ny - ny2, bg);
  184: }
  185: 
  186: /* Insert characters. */
  187: void
  188: grid_view_insert_cells(struct grid *gd, u_int px, u_int py, u_int nx, u_int bg)
  189: {
  190: 	u_int	sx;
  191: 
  192: 	px = grid_view_x(gd, px);
  193: 	py = grid_view_y(gd, py);
  194: 
  195: 	sx = grid_view_x(gd, gd->sx);
  196: 
  197: 	if (px >= sx - 1)
  198: 		grid_clear(gd, px, py, 1, 1, bg);
  199: 	else
  200: 		grid_move_cells(gd, px + nx, px, py, sx - px - nx, bg);
  201: }
  202: 
  203: /* Delete characters. */
  204: void
  205: grid_view_delete_cells(struct grid *gd, u_int px, u_int py, u_int nx, u_int bg)
  206: {
  207: 	u_int	sx;
  208: 
  209: 	px = grid_view_x(gd, px);
  210: 	py = grid_view_y(gd, py);
  211: 
  212: 	sx = grid_view_x(gd, gd->sx);
  213: 
  214: 	grid_move_cells(gd, px, px + nx, py, sx - px - nx, bg);
  215: 	grid_clear(gd, sx - nx, py, px + nx - (sx - nx), 1, bg);
  216: }
  217: 
  218: /* Convert cells into a string. */
  219: char *
  220: grid_view_string_cells(struct grid *gd, u_int px, u_int py, u_int nx)
  221: {
  222: 	px = grid_view_x(gd, px);
  223: 	py = grid_view_y(gd, py);
  224: 
  225: 	return (grid_string_cells(gd, px, py, nx, NULL, 0, 0, 0));
  226: }
